Robert Russell, M.D., MPH, a professor in UAB’s Department of Surgery and director of the trauma program at Children’s of Alabama, was recently appointed as an Associate Editor for the Journal of Surgical Research (JSR).

Russell was appointed to the editorial board following years of service as an ad hoc reviewer and multiple recent scholarly contributions to JSR. In 2024 and 2025, he authored several articles in the journal highlighting key advances in pediatric surgical care.  

He has over published over 120 peer reviewed manuscripts. These publications reflect Russell’s commitment to improving pediatric surgical care, outcomes for critically injured children and advancing evidence-based resuscitation strategies.

Journal of Surgical Research is the official publication of the Association for Academic Surgery, which is published 14 times per year, and serves as a central platform for disseminating high-impact surgical research across specialties. As of June 2025, it holds an impact factor of 1.7, with a five-year impact factor of 2.0, placing it in the first quartile for surgical journals. The journal is indexed in major databases including PubMed, Web of Science, Scopus, and Embase.

“I’m honored to join the editorial leadership of JSR,” said Russell. “This journal has long been a cornerstone of surgical research and education, and I’m excited to contribute to its mission of fostering innovation and excellence in academic surgery.”
